Davido Takes Kigali by Storm! Top Tracks & Sold-Out Concert Buzz
Nigerian superstar Davido recently touched down in Kigali, igniting a wave of excitement for what is anticipated to be one of Rwanda's premier music events. Arriving at Kigali International Airport, he was met by a large crowd of journalists and enthusiastic fans, all eager to catch a glimpse of the global hitmaker. Despite the intense media attention and fan fervor, Davido, accompanied by his stylists, management, and instrumentalists, moved swiftly through the airport under tight security, opting not to speak to the press. Amused by the attention, he captured the moment by filming the crowd with his iPhone and later confirmed his arrival in Rwanda via an Instagram post, further fueling the anticipation for his performance.
Davido is poised to electrify the BK Arena on December 5th as part of his highly acclaimed '5ive Tour' world tour, a concert that has already generated immense buzz across the country and sold out days in advance. Fans across Rwanda are eagerly preparing for a spectacular night promising a dynamic fusion of Afrobeats, dance, and a celebration of global collaborations. The event will also feature top Rwandan acts, including Kitoko Bibarwa, making it a truly unmissable musical spectacle.
The centerpiece of this tour is Davido's fifth studio album, '5ive,' which was released in April of this year. Comprising 17 tracks, the album masterfully blends various genres such as Afropop, Afrobeats, Amapiano, R&B, dancehall, and global pop. It features significant collaborations with both renowned African and international artists, which collectively enhance its global appeal while steadfastly maintaining Afrobeats at its core. '5ive' has been celebrated for its strong compositions, promising an unforgettable live experience.
Among the album's standout tracks are several that have resonated deeply with audiences. 'With You,' featuring Omah Lay, serves as the album's emotional closing song and has struck a global chord. It is a rich blend of melody and Afro rhythms combined with emotional depth, making it an ideal candidate for live shows where crowd sing-alongs are expected to be a highlight.
'Offa Me,' a collaboration with Victoria Monét, further solidifies Davido's prominent position in the music industry, showcasing his distinctive style and lyrical prowess. The track's infectious sounds and poignant lyrics contribute to its noteworthy status. Blending Afrobeats with R&B, 'Offa Me' stands out as one of the album's more internationally flavored compositions, demonstrating Davido's ability to create music that connects with diverse listeners.
'Funds,' featuring Odumodublvck and Chike, was released as one of the lead singles prior to the album's full launch. This track brilliantly mixes Afrobeats and Amapiano influences, creating an anthem that celebrates hustle and success. The 2024 record is made even more impressive by the collaboration with two award-winning superstars, Odumodublvck and Chike, whose unique talents and captivating verses elevate the song to new heights.
'Be There Still' is a powerful solo track that offers a lighter, more melodic touch, showcasing Davido's versatility beyond his high-profile collaborations. This 'symphony' beautifully displays his unique style, lyrical skill, ingenuity, and remarkable talent for crafting a musical experience that transcends traditional boundaries. The song features catchy instrumentals created by Marvey Muzique, DJ Maphorisa, and Black Culture, contributing to its distinct appeal.
Finally, 'Titanium,' a high-profile collaboration with Chris Brown, expertly blends Afrobeats with global R&B vibes. In this track, both artists reflect on the pain and challenges they have encountered, affirming that they have emerged stronger, unbreakable, and self-assured. The song serves as a powerful declaration of inner strength, resilience, and self-worth, emphatically stating a refusal to be broken by external forces. Given both artists' past encounters with public criticism and controversy, this track stands as a testament to their unwavering spirit.
